轻松管理学生成绩
学生个人成绩查询对于教师来说是一项核心任务。为了提高学生查询成绩的效率和便利性,我决定开发一个学生个人成绩查询小程序。下面我将以教师的视角,详细介绍如何制作这个小程序。不过,如果您缺乏相关技术支持,我会推荐使用类似易查分这样的现成工具,它们更便捷且实用。
在开始制作这个小程序之前,首先要明确需求。通过与学校管理层和学生们的沟通,我了解到以下几个主要需求:
学生能够随时随地查询自己的成绩。
教师能够快速查看、管理学生的成绩。
确保学生个人信息的安全性和隐私性。
基于以上需求,我选择了微信小程序作为开发平台。微信小程序拥有广泛的用户基础和强大的开发工具,能够满足我们的需求。
为了储存学生们的成绩信息,我们需要设计并建立一个数据库。在这里,我选择了关系型数据库MySQL,并设立了以下三个表:
学生信息表:用于储存学生的基本信息,包括学号、姓名、班级等。
课程信息表:用于储存课程的相关信息,包括课程编号、课程名称等。
成绩信息表:用于储存学生的成绩信息,包括学号、课程编号和成绩等。
在后端开发中,我选择了Node.js作为开发语言,并使用了Express框架。通过与数据库的交互,我实现了以下三个主要功能:
学生登录:学生可以使用学号和密码登录小程序来查询自己的成绩。
成绩查询:学生登录后,可以查看自己的各科成绩和总评成绩。
成绩录入:教师可以登录小程序,录入学生的成绩信息。
在前端的开发中,我使用了微信小程序提供的开发工具进行设计和开发。通过调用后端接口,实现了以下三个主要功能:
学生登录界面:设计了简洁明了的登录界面,学生们可以输入学号和密码进行登录。
成绩查询界面:登录后,学生们可以在这个界面查看自己的各科成绩和总评成绩。
成绩录入界面:教师登录后,可以在这个界面录入学生的成绩信息并保存,操作简单方便。
通过以上介绍,相信大家已了解到学生个人成绩查询小程序的制作流程。如果你也是一名教师且缺乏相关技术支持,我会推荐你考虑使用类似易查分这样的现成工具来快速实现这一功能,因为它们不仅更为便捷,而且实用性极高。